I’m never wrong, sometimes — take Roswell

My published preseason prediction: Peachtree will struggle to live up to the hype and will finish 7-3. I also drafted LaDainian Tomlinson with my first pick (No. 3 overall) in a fantasy football draft.

Clearly, I’m never wrong.

The hype that surrounded the Ridge stemmed from a team filled with D-I talent. The struggle would come from a team that had has its fair share of infighting. From players getting in fights and yelling at coaches to passionate parents griping about playing time, Ridge coach Blair Armstrong has dealt with it all. Even if he loses in Saturday’s 5A final, he’s coach of the year hands down. Yet, on Nov. 21, I failed to even list him in the candidates for Gwinnett coach of the year.

Clearly, I’m wrong a lot.

I’ll let you decide which I am this week — Roswell, 24-13
